Hole In The Ear With A Smelly Discharge - Reach out to a doctor. A preauricular pit is a small hole or cyst just in front of your ear above your ear canal. Infection of the preauricular sinus can result in smelly discharge, which needs treatment with antibiotics. A preauricular pit is a small hole in front of the ear, toward the face, that some people are born with. This hole marks a sinus tract under the skin.
